Interesting insight in healthcare here: as we encourage patients to take more control of their condition and relive the burden on the HCP, does tech become the third party, taking control from both?
I’ve worked with insights while consulting to healthcare for 20 years now. However, I never get over how different it feels to experience insight as the patient. This summer marks 30 years since my diagnosis with Type 1 Diabetes. I’ve lived through a number of medical innovations… from mixing insulin in a syringe, to insulin pumps, to the Freestyle Libre flash glucometer. Just this week (happy anniversary!) I started on the Medtronic “hybrid closed loop” continuous glucometry system. A mouthful. But basically, a sensor under my skin talks to my pump, which controls my insulin. An algorithm calculates my basal rates… learning all the time. And all I have to do is dose for meals. Here's the thing… I’ve found the ‘loss of control’ disconcerting as hell. Ironic, given that my actual blood glucose control has been fantastic (see my graph). But from an emotional experience perspective, having been used to doing math, and doing corrections, and having to troubleshoot… I feel like I’m a third wheel now. It’s been a fascinating feeling. Having to do less, and being in better range, but feeling … lost a bit. I’m sure it will pass. And I have no doubt it's for the better, healthwise. But I wonder if Medtronic knew how their amazing tech would leave dyed-in-the-wool diabetics feeling on the other side of it.
